Education – Alternative Schools – Reporting Requirements and Restrictions

Sponsor: Debra Davis (District 28)Committee: Ways and MeansSubject: Primary and Secondary EducationStatus: First Reading Education, Health, and Environmental Affairs (as of Nov 6, 2020)

What this bill does

Official synopsis

Requiring each county board of education, beginning in the 2020-2021 school year, to report certain data and information for each alternative school within its jurisdiction to the State Department of Education; requiring the Department, on or before October 1 each year, beginning in 2021, to report to the Governor and the General Assembly the data and information required to be reported by the county boards; prohibiting the required enrollment of certain students from public schools in an alternative school, with a certain exception; etc.
